Abstract
Electrochemical measurements and surface observations have been made to clarify the effects of debris and residual carbon film in circulated water on corrosion behavior of copper tube for air conditioning system. Proper usage of water treatment agent has kept tube surface corrosion-resistant, regardless of surface with or without residual carbon film. It is electrochemically and morphologically indicated that debris such as corrosion product in circulated water causes damages of the tube surface and then leads to occurrence of localized corrosion such as pitting attacks in some situations.
